When the workday ends, it’s easy for me to slip from one screen to another — emails fade into scrolling, and before I know it, the day is gone. I need to change my habits and stop relying on digital friends and work colleges for connection.
Connection outside of work reminds us who we are beyond our roles and routines.
Call a friend just to laugh. Join a class that feeds your creativity. Share a meal without distractions. Leave your device in your bag and talk to the children or your partner.
These small acts of connection refill the spaces that work often drains.
It’s not about doing more — it’s about being more present. When we nurture relationships, community, and simple joy, we return to work (and to ourselves) lighter, calmer, and more whole.
Your well-being grows in the spaces between — make room for them.
